Output d5f38d23c182677869f90eee8c3c133a2615f51e545b3a2d21ebff19c4e44ebe:0

value
100802496
script pubkey
OP_0 OP_PUSHBYTES_20 84e8bf1768e6d31d16cae2cb494aa2aa62e35a94
address
bc1qsn5t79mgumf369k2ut95jj4z4f3wxk55uu98r8
transaction
d5f38d23c182677869f90eee8c3c133a2615f51e545b3a2d21ebff19c4e44ebe
confirmations
124545
spent
true